DVAX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2014 in Review

117 of the 3,481 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Dynavax Technologies (DVAX) for Q2 2014, worth a combined $282M — down 20% from $352M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 19 funds opened new DVAX positions and 12 closed out — a net gain of 7 holders — while 29 added to existing stakes and 39 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Clough Capital Partners, opening a new position worth an estimated $4.04M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$11M.
